uunit/
electronvolts.rs

1use crate::*;
2pub type UnitElectronvolts = DimensionStruct<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
3pub type Electronvolts<T> = Quantity<T, UnitElectronvolts>;
4pub type UnitQuettaelectronvolts = DimensionStruct<P30,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
5pub type Quettaelectronvolts<T> = Quantity<T, UnitQuettaelectronvolts>;
6pub type UnitRonnaelectronvolts = DimensionStruct<P27,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
7pub type Ronnaelectronvolts<T> = Quantity<T, UnitRonnaelectronvolts>;
8pub type UnitYottaelectronvolts = DimensionStruct<P24,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
9pub type Yottaelectronvolts<T> = Quantity<T, UnitYottaelectronvolts>;
10pub type UnitZettaelectronvolts = DimensionStruct<P21,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
11pub type Zettaelectronvolts<T> = Quantity<T, UnitZettaelectronvolts>;
12pub type UnitExaelectronvolts = DimensionStruct<P18,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
13pub type Exaelectronvolts<T> = Quantity<T, UnitExaelectronvolts>;
14pub type UnitPetaelectronvolts = DimensionStruct<P15,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
15pub type Petaelectronvolts<T> = Quantity<T, UnitPetaelectronvolts>;
16pub type UnitTeraelectronvolts = DimensionStruct<P12,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
17pub type Teraelectronvolts<T> = Quantity<T, UnitTeraelectronvolts>;
18pub type UnitGigaelectronvolts = DimensionStruct<P9,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
19pub type Gigaelectronvolts<T> = Quantity<T, UnitGigaelectronvolts>;
20pub type UnitMegaelectronvolts = DimensionStruct<P6,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
21pub type Megaelectronvolts<T> = Quantity<T, UnitMegaelectronvolts>;
22pub type UnitKiloelectronvolts = DimensionStruct<P3,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
23pub type Kiloelectronvolts<T> = Quantity<T, UnitKiloelectronvolts>;
24pub type UnitHectoelectronvolts = DimensionStruct<P2,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
25pub type Hectoelectronvolts<T> = Quantity<T, UnitHectoelectronvolts>;
26pub type UnitDecaelectronvolts = DimensionStruct<P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
27pub type Decaelectronvolts<T> = Quantity<T, UnitDecaelectronvolts>;
28pub type UnitDecielectronvolts = DimensionStruct<N1,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
29pub type Decielectronvolts<T> = Quantity<T, UnitDecielectronvolts>;
30pub type UnitCentielectronvolts = DimensionStruct<N2,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
31pub type Centielectronvolts<T> = Quantity<T, UnitCentielectronvolts>;
32pub type UnitMillielectronvolts = DimensionStruct<N3,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
33pub type Millielectronvolts<T> = Quantity<T, UnitMillielectronvolts>;
34pub type UnitMicroelectronvolts = DimensionStruct<N6,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
35pub type Microelectronvolts<T> = Quantity<T, UnitMicroelectronvolts>;
36pub type UnitNanoelectronvolts = DimensionStruct<N9,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
37pub type Nanoelectronvolts<T> = Quantity<T, UnitNanoelectronvolts>;
38pub type UnitPicoelectronvolts = DimensionStruct<N12,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
39pub type Picoelectronvolts<T> = Quantity<T, UnitPicoelectronvolts>;
40pub type UnitFemtoelectronvolts = DimensionStruct<N15,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
41pub type Femtoelectronvolts<T> = Quantity<T, UnitFemtoelectronvolts>;
42pub type UnitAttoelectronvolts = DimensionStruct<N18,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
43pub type Attoelectronvolts<T> = Quantity<T, UnitAttoelectronvolts>;
44pub type UnitZeptoelectronvolts = DimensionStruct<N21,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
45pub type Zeptoelectronvolts<T> = Quantity<T, UnitZeptoelectronvolts>;
46pub type UnitYoctoelectronvolts = DimensionStruct<N24,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
47pub type Yoctoelectronvolts<T> = Quantity<T, UnitYoctoelectronvolts>;
48pub type UnitRontoelectronvolts = DimensionStruct<N27,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
49pub type Rontoelectronvolts<T> = Quantity<T, UnitRontoelectronvolts>;
50pub type UnitQuectoelectronvolts = DimensionStruct<N30,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, Z0, P1, Z0, Z0, Z0, Z0, Z0, Z0, Z0>;
51pub type Quectoelectronvolts<T> = Quantity<T, UnitQuectoelectronvolts>;